100 Examples of sentences containing the verb "juggle around"

Definition

Juggle around refers to the act of manipulating or managing multiple tasks, responsibilities, or objects simultaneously, often in a way that requires skill and coordination. It can also imply rearranging or adjusting priorities in order to accommodate different demands or interests.
